CM Murad inaugurates smart, transparent traffic system

October 28, 2025 by Sajid Salamat

Sindh Chief Minister Syed Murad Ali Shah inaugurated the Traffic Regulation and Citation System (TRACS) at CPO, marking a significant milestone in the province’s digital transformation and governance reforms. Japanese envoy inaugurates education initiative in Khyber

February 24, 2021 by Saqib

ISLAMABAD: Ambassador of Japan to Pakistan Matsuda Kuninori on Wednesday inaugurated the project for re-expansion of Primary School in Village Raziq Kalay being managed by Learning Awareness and Motivation Programme (LAMP), a non-governmental organisation, in Khyber tribal district of Khyber Pakhtunkhwa province. NA Speaker inaugurates cricket camp for parliamentarians

April 18, 2019 by DailyTimes.pk

A training camp has been organised at the Shalimar Cricket Ground for parliamentarians who will participate in the Inter-Parliamentary Cricket Tournament, scheduled to be held this July in the United Kingdom.
